SPIDER is a free website that helps identify social services ranging from counseling to food. Here are the collaborators and our roles:
1.

The Service Provider Identification & Exploration Resource (SPIDER) application and its predecessor, the Statewide Provider Database (SPD), is a collaborative effort sponsored by the IL Department of Children & Family Services, with data maintenance and user support provided by the Northwestern University/Hospital Feinberg School of Medicine, technology resources provided by the IL Department of I

Sometimes you need more than a little help. Large comprehensive agencies can provide interconnected options in one place. In Aurora Illinois, one organization is providing multiple services so "individuals impacted by domestic violence, sexual violence, and substance use are able to reclaim their power". By providing these services, Mutual Ground hopes to fulfill its mission to heal communities and find equity for all. You can find Mutual Grand and other comprehensive social service agency in the SPIDER database. Complete a free search 24 hours a day/ 7 days week.

Today we're highlighting Freedom House. where residents in the heart of the Illinois looking for gender-inclusive domestic violence services can find support.
At offices in places like Kewanee and Princeton, Domestic Violence survivors can find compassionate counseling, emergency shelter, and legal aid regardless of gender or sexual orientation.
Services for everyone is just one more reason to find what you need at the SPIDER database, 24/7. https://spider.dcfs.illinois.gov/

Can't calm your fussy baby? SPIDER has help for that! The Fussy Baby Network has help on call and even home visitors if you have concerns about your infants’ crying, sleeping, or feeding. This free service helps hundreds of families calm and soothe babies and is waiting for you if you need it. 1-888-431-2229
One example of how SPIDER has programs across the lifespan from the smallest and cutest Illinois residents to the oldest and wisest. View our website today. https://spider.dcfs.illinois.gov/
